I have also had this problem for a while. It also happens when I use Ham Radio Deluxe, although less frequently. I am also using N8VB's virtual port, but I have tried several other virutal ports with the same results.When I run Port Monitor it appears as if PowerSDR quits responding to commands sent by MixW or Ham Radio Deluxe.

I have found that if I set PowerSDR to 300 baud and MixW to 1200 baud it seems to work in a more stable manner. (I know you don't normally set the baud rate to different speed's, but this does seem to work with the Virutal Serial Port) When It does loose connection of I simply uncheck "Use Cat" in PowerSDR and recheck it and it immediately starts communicating again. I do not have to restart PowerSDR.

I use CAT from MixW.  After the Power Console and MixW have been
running for awhile, CAT stops working.  None of the settings have
changed.  Start and stop MixW, no change.  Stop both the Power
Console and MixW and restart, Power Console first, and CAT is
restored.  I don't know the length of the period CAT will run,
whether it is a time problem or number of CAT commands you send
problem.  I'll try to find this out and report.  All the commands I
have sent are good and work, and MixW is monitoring frequency, mode
and a few other parameters every time they change.  I'm using N8VB
with com 6 on the Power Console and com 5 on MixW for CAT, and com  4
on the Power Console and com 5 on MixW for secondary CW key.  PTT is CAT.
